Abstract

The paper is devoted to the study of operational matrix method for approximating solution for nonlinear coupled system fractional differential equations. The main aim of this paper is to approximate solution for the problem under two different types of boundary conditions, m ^ -point nonlocal boundary conditions and mixed derivative boundary conditions. We develop some new operational matrices. These matrices are used along with some previously derived results to convert the problem under consideration into a system of easily solvable matrix equations. The convergence of the developed scheme is studied analytically and is conformed by solving some test problems.
